WebSep 22, 2024 · In either the Instagram app or the Facebook app, go to Settings > Accounts Center > Accounts & profiles. Choose an account and tap Remove. If both accounts share the same password, you must change one of them. To limit interaction between Instagram and Facebook, go to Accounts Center > tap Sharing Across Profiles.
